Will Bezzecchi be the 13th pole sitter in 13 Assen GPs?

History beckons with Saturday's qualifying around the corner as MotoGP™ could witness 13 different pole sitters over the past 13 Grand Prix

Marco Bezzecchi (Mooney VR46 Racing Team) started the weekend with a dominant display across Practice, and is one of 17 riders on the grid who could be etching their names in the history books as Assen's 13th different polesitter across the past 13 Grand Prix at the iconic venue.  

Aleix Espargaro (Aprilia Racing), Johann Zarco (Prima Pramac Racing), Marc Marquez (Repsol Honda Team), Fabio Quartarao (Monster Energy Yamaha MotoGP™), Maverick Viñales (Aprilia Racing), and Francesco Bagnaia (Ducati Lenovo Team) have all started from pole position in Assen, leaving it up to someone else to be the number 13. Espargaro took the honours in 2014, followed by Zarco in 2017, Marquez (2018), Quartararo (2019), Viñales (2021), with Bagnaia taking the most recent pole in 2022. 

You wouldn't put it past any of those names to end the streak, as the bunch join some household names in the Assen polesitter club. The other six riders that make up the dozen include Jorge Lorenzo (2010), Marco Simoncelli (2011), Casey Stoner (2012), Cal Crutchlow (2013), Valentino Rossi (2015), and Andrea Dovizioso (2016).
